Job description

What Your Day Will Look Like:

As a Senior Air Quality Specialist, you will play a crucial role in addressing air quality challenges across a wide range of projects. Your expertise will be applied to developing innovative solutions to mitigate air pollution, ensuring compliance with environmental regulations, and providing strategic guidance to clients and internal teams. You will be responsible for conducting and overseeing air quality modeling, emissions inventories, and regulatory analysis to support infrastructure, industrial, and development projects. Your work will include liaising with government agencies, collaborating with multi-disciplinary teams, and developing air monitoring programs and impact assessments. Whether you’re overseeing field assessments, mentoring junior staff, or contributing to business development efforts, your technical insight and leadership will drive positive environmental outcomes. Additionally, you will participate in stakeholder consultations, contribute to policy development, and enhance best practices in air quality management within the organization.

What You'll Do:

  • Lead air quality assessments, dispersion modeling, and emissions inventories for diverse multi-disciplinary projects.
  • Develop air quality monitoring programs and analyze data to support regulatory compliance and project approvals, develop baseline, and impact assessments.
  • Provide expert advice on air quality regulations and best practices.
  • Prepare and review technical reports, proposals, and regulatory submissions, including supporting environmental approvals and permitting processes.
  • Collaborate with internal multi-disciplinary teams, clients, government agencies, and internal teams to develop project strategies.
  • Mentor junior staff and contribute to technical training.
  • Manage projects including technical work delivery, budget, schedule, and communications.
  • Conduct site visits and oversee air quality sampling and testing programs.
  • Lead environmental permitting processes and liaise with regulatory bodies. Engage with stakeholders, government agencies and Indigenous communities.
  • Develop and implement air quality mitigation strategies for complex projects.
  • Build and maintain internal and external client relationships, and work with the senior leadership team to help drive the business plan.
  • Occasional travel and overtime may be required.

What You'll Need:

  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in environmental science, engineering, or a related field.
  • 10+ years of experience in air quality assessment and regulatory compliance.
  • Proficiency in air dispersion modeling software (e.g., AERMOD, CALPUFF).
  • Strong knowledge of federal and provincial environmental regulations.
  • Experience with stakeholder engagement and permitting processes.
  • Strong project management skills, including the ability to prioritize tasks and manage multiple projects simultaneously as well as all aspects of project development and delivery (i.e., proposal through to deliverables, including time and budget management).
  • Valid Ontario driver’s licence is required.
